免费试用

中文化、本土化、云端化的在线跨平台软件开发工具,支持APP、电脑端、小程序、IOS免签等等

app怎么根据原型图开发界面

在开发一个App的时候,根据原型图设计界面是非常重要的一步。原型图可以让开发团队和设计团队更好地理解和沟通产品的需求和功能,以及界面设计的细节。

根据原型图开发界面的过程可以简单分为以下几个步骤:

1. 分析原型图:首先,我们需要仔细分析原型图,理解每个界面的布局、功能和交互细节。原型图通常由UI设计师设计,包含了各种界面元素、按钮、输入框等等。

2. 确定技术栈:根据原型图的设计样式和功能要求,我们需要选择合适的技术栈来开发界面。例如,如果原型图中有复杂的交互效果,我们可以选择使用React Native或Flutter来开发;如果界面比较简单,我们可以选择使用原生开发语言,如Java或Swift。

3. 布局界面:在开发界面之前,我们首先要确定每个界面的布局。根据原型图中的设计样式和排版要求,我们可以使用各种布局方式来布置界面元素,如线性布局、网格布局或相对布局。

4. 添加界面元素:一旦布局确定,我们就可以开始添加界面元素,如文本框、按钮、图片等等。根据原型图中的设计要求,我们可以使用各种UI库或自定义界面元素来满足需求。

5. 实现交互功能:开发界面不仅仅是静态的呈现,还需要实现各种交互功能。根据原型图中的交互设计,我们可以添加点击事件、滑动事件或其他用户操作事件来实现交互功能。

6. 调试和优化:在界面开发完成后,我们需要进行调试和优化。测试界面在不同设备上的兼容性,修复可能存在的bug并进行性能优化。

总结起来,根据原型图开发界面的过程包括分析原型图、确定技术栈、布局界面、添加界面元素、实现交互功能、调试和优化等步骤。这个过程需要团队间的合作和沟通,以确保最终开发出符合设计要求的界面。


相关知识:
kivy开发的app能商用吗
Kivy是一个开源的Python框架,用于快速开发跨平台的移动应用程序和其他多媒体应用。它使用了一种创新的方式来构建用户界面,即通过使用声明式语言和自动化图形计算,减少了繁琐的手动布局和渲染操作。Kivy具有跨平台的特性,可以在Windows、MacOS、
2023-07-14
app开发者需要更新此ap
App开发者在更新应用程序时,需要考虑多个方面,包括功能改进、性能优化、安全性提升等。本文将介绍更新应用程序的原理和详细步骤。1. 更新应用程序的原理应用程序更新是为了修复现有版本的问题,改进用户体验,并添加新功能。当开发者准备更新应用程序时,他们通常会遵
2023-06-29
app开发前后端简易流程图
App开发是一项复杂的过程,涉及到前端和后端两个核心部分。在这篇文章中,我将为您介绍App开发的简易流程图,并对其中的原理和细节进行详细解释。App开发的前端部分主要涉及用户界面的设计和开发,而后端部分则处理数据的存储和处理。下面是一个简化的App开发流程
2023-06-29
app开发一般费用多少钱啊
App开发的费用因项目的复杂程度、功能需求、设计要求、开发平台等因素而异。在讨论费用之前,我们先来了解一下App开发的一般流程和所需的基本步骤。1. 需求分析:在项目启动之前,开发团队会与客户进行需求沟通和分析,明确功能需求、用户界面设计、平台适配等方面的
2023-06-29
app开发一个商城
APP开发一个商城是目前互联网领域非常热门的一个项目。一个成功的商城APP需要具备一系列的功能,例如用户注册登录、商品浏览、购物车管理、订单提交、支付功能等等。下面我将为大家介绍APP开发一个商城的原理和详细步骤。1.需求分析:首先,我们需要明确商城APP
2023-06-29
app插件开发教程
一、插件的概念插件是一种非常常见的应用程序扩展方式,其本质上是一种独立的小型应用程序,能够无缝地集成到主程序中,为主程序提供特定的功能或服务。插件通常被设计成易于安装、卸载、更新和升级,它们可以在不影响主程序的情况下改变主程序的行为,非常适合用于增强主程序
2023-05-06